Arm Amputation Through The Upper Arm Bone, With Implant

Montana rates for HCPCS 24931

Amputation of the arm through the upper-arm bone, with an implant fitted at the cut end of the bone during the same operation. Bone and soft tissue are shaped and the end is closed with well-padded tissue so the limb can later take an artificial arm. It is done for severe injury, infection, loss of blood supply, or a tumor.
